What is the course about?

On this course, you will have the opportunity to review, develop your knowledge of sentence structures and grammatical functions, as well as having the opportunity to learn new grammar points. You will also have the opportunity to improve your speaking and listening skills as well as consolidate your reading and writing skills.

What will we cover?

The focus will be on revision and consolidation of previously learnt language, together with learning new verbs and vocabulary and plenty of opportunity to practise speaking and listening skills.

What will I achieve?
By the end of this course you should be able to...

Express yourself using more complex sentences
Develop your vocabulary
Enhance your fluency and accuracy in speaking
Improve your listening and reading of Japanese
Consolidate grammatical structures.

What level is the course and do I need any particular skills?

Ideally you would be working towards Japanese Language Proficiency Exam N4 or have an equivalent level. Students should be able to read and write Hiragana and Katakana and have some knowledge of Kanji. This course suits students whose level is already upper intermediate but not yet advanced.

How will I be taught, and will there be any work outside the class?

Our courses are characterised by spoken interaction and communication. Typical activities include pair work,
group work, role plays, games and discussions of topics.
A range of resources will be used to support your learning including presentations, hand-outs, and audio-visual material.
Homework is highly recommended to consolidate learning.
